Empa is a research institution of the ETH Domain.The nanotech@surfaces Laboratory is looking for a highly motivated candidate with a strong experimental background in Solid State Physics, Surface Science or Quantum Nanoscience who wants to pursue cutting-edge research at a world-class level.Your tasks
In this project, you will synthesize and characterize strongly correlated quantum many-body spin systems using methods based on scanning probe microscopy (SPM). You will study local excitations at the single spin site level in bottom-up fabricated nanographene chains using a low-temperature scanning tunneling microscope. In combination with multiconfigurational simulations, such experiments will determine the energetics and dynamics of electronic and spin excitations in these strongly correlated quantum many-body systems. Obtaining precise and flexible control over spin sites and interactions will open ways toward the operation of carbon-based quantum spin devices.Your profile
